The Tidewater Academy Warriors lost against the Fuqua Falcons back in January,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Tuesday. Tidewater Academy took a 53-48 hit to the loss column at the hands of Fuqua. Tidewater Academy has now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Sam Minix was his usual excellent self, scoring 22 points along with six rebounds and three blocks for Fuqua. That makes it eight consecutive games in which Minix has scored at least a third of Fuqua's points. Mason Pleasants was another key contributor, scoring 13 points along with six rebounds and two steals.
Tidewater Academy has traveled a rocky road recently having lost 13 of their last 14 games, which put a noticeable dent in their 4-17 record this season. As for Fuqua, their victory bumped their record up to 4-16.
